Berdella

An elaborate feminized form of Berdell or Berda, with the -ella suffix adding Italian romance to Germanic roots. The name conveys elegance and theatrical flair, appealing to parents seeking something ornate and distinctly vintage-feminine.

Rare contemporary usage, primarily historical American (early 20th century).
